Property Description

Closing Date for Offers - Monday 9th February at 12pm.

Blending contemporary finishes with traditional features, this charming one-bedroom first-floor tenement flat has been beautifully maintained and upgraded over the years with thoughtful modern enhancements. Enjoying bright easterly aspects from the Living room’s striking three section bay window and the wonderful and spacious dining room with westerly aspects over the communal gardens and beyond. Perfectly situated in the sought-after Garnethill district, tucked between the vibrant West End and the bustling City Centre, the flat offers unrivalled access to the best of both neighbourhoods. Garnethill is celebrated as one of Glasgow’s most creative and characterful areas, home to cultural landmarks including the Glasgow School of Art, the Royal Conservatoire of Scotland and the Glasgow Film Theatre, and benefits from excellent transport connections.

Accessed via secure entry to communal close, there is stair access to top floor entrance. The property extends to a generous 706 sq ft and comprises of entrance vestibule with cloakroom cupboard, welcoming reception hallway, living room spanning over 18 ft into bay with a wealth of period features and traditional fireplace, cleverly reconfigured from the recess, there is a galley style kitchen raised from a fabulous dining space, tastefully refitted with bespoke kitchen; generous bedroom with fitted wardrobes and a modern and recently refitted bathroom with bath, over bath shower and window to west. Viewing is highly recommended to appreciate the quality of fixtures and fittings. The property is recently re-decorated throughout, has quality real wood floorcoverings, original restored doors, restored sash and case windows and gas central heating system with modern chrome horizontal ladder style radiators. The building has well-maintained communal gardens to the rear, and the property has access to a Residents Parking Permit for parking on street outside the property.

Situation

Located on Buccleuch Street in Garnethill; a quiet and predominantly residential area, only few minutes’ walk from Sauchiehall Street, which has undergone a major public realm improvements programme. Nearby transport options from a selection of over ground and underground train stations including Charing Cross Station, St Georges Cross Underground Station or Cowcaddens Underground Station. The property is conveniently located for access to the City Centre, the Merchant City, International Financial Services District, the West End and Finnieston where a wealth of amenities including both general and specialist shopping, and many highly acclaimed wine bars and restaurants can be found. The property is in close proximity to the Glasgow School of Art; Strathclyde, Caledonian & Glasgow Universities. The area benefits from frequent public transport with easy access to nearby subway stations; Queens Street and Central Train Stations. The nearby M8/M80 ensures good commuter access throughout the Central Belt and is within easy reach of some of Scotland’s most impressive countryside attractions.
